MaineHealth


MaineHealth is a not-for-profit integrated health system whose vision is, “Working together so our communities are the healthiest in America.” It consists of nine local health systems, a comprehensive behavioral healthcare network, diagnostic services, home health agencies, and 1,700 employed providers working together through the MaineHealth Medical Group. With approximately 22,000 employees, MaineHealth provides preventive care, diagnosis and treatment to 1.1 million residents in Maine and New Hampshire.
Several of our community hospitals have been recognized by The Leapfrog Group as Top Rural Hospitals. Additionally, The Leapfrog Group has given Hospital Safety “A” Grades to Maine Medical Center, Southern Maine Health Care and Mid Coast–Parkview Health for spring 2022. Our Maine hospitals are all Maine Tobacco-Free Hospital Network Gold Star Standard of Excellence recipients at the Platinum level. Accreditation from The Joint Commission and inclusions in Becker’s Hospital Review and U.S. News and World Report round out our recognition from leaders in U.S. health care evaluation.

Our Vision
Working together so our communities are the healthiest in America.
Our Mission
MaineHealth is a not-for-profit health system dedicated to improving the health of our patients and communities by providing high-quality affordable care, educating tomorrow's caregivers, and researching better ways to provide care.
Our Values
At MaineHealth, our values are at the very core of living our mission and vision of working together so our communities are the healthiest in America. Wherever and whenever you interact with us, you can expect our team members to embody the following values in action:
- Patient Centered: We focus on each individual's unique needs, and partner with the people we care for, their families and care teams to develop a shared plan.
- Respect: We embrace diversity and recognize the value of each person.
- Integrity: We are honest, transparent and ethical, and maintain a culture of trust and accountability.
- Excellence: We set high standards and always strive to exceed expectations.
- Ownership: We take responsibility for our actions, follow through on our commitments, and approach challenges with optimism.
- Innovation: We welcome diverse perspectives, embrace change, and are committed to lifelong learning.

Diversity, Equity & Inclusion
In 2020, MaineHealth made a commitment to advance (DEI) throughout our system. We established a system-wide DEI department that supports this commitment through focused development of a welcoming, respectful, equitable and inclusive environment. By focusing on DEI, we are developing a culture that respects and values uniqueness — allowing care team members to bring their whole selves to work. When our care team members can be themselves, they can be at their best. In a health care environment, that means providing the best possible patient care.
